Businesses in New York City are still making second hand lithium ion batteries which have been causing a large number of fires.
Since the manufacturing and sale of refurbished lithium ion batteries was made illegal in New York City last year, the fire department has conducted hundreds of inspections and handed out around 200 fines.
"Unregulated, tampered with and non certified batteries are extremely dangerous and deadly. They kill people."
Fire Commissioner Laura Kavanagh says this week, Wilson Scooters in Queens was fined after Inspectors found a large number of battery packs, individual cells and e bikes. Lithium ion batteries caused 268 fires in the city last year.
